How to use this Designing Cost-Optimized Architectures practice set
Work each question without looking at the explanation. Mark the items you are unsure of even when you guess correctly — those are the high-leverage ones to study. After submitting, review every explanation, even on the items you got right; the rationale often introduces an exam-relevant nuance that will appear on a future drill in this series. Then move on to the next variant in the Designing Cost-Optimized Architectures sequence and repeat with a 24-hour gap so spaced repetition can do its work.
